62-Year-Old Meochor Mebdoza Was Killed In A Motor Vehicle Accident in Clovis (Clovis, CA)

6 July 2023/Source: Your Central Valley

The Fresno County Coroner’s Office identified the man who was killed by a Clovis Fire Department Vehicle in a motor vehicle accident on July 4th at Clovis Avenue and Barstow Avenue.

The victim was identified to be 62-year-old Melchor Mendoza. He was hit by a fire department truck driven by a fire department supervisor while walking across the road. Mendoza was fatally injured and was pronounced dead at the scene said the officers. 

It is not yet known if alcohol or drugs played a role in the collision. The cause of the fatal crash is still being investigated. There are no other details available at this time.
